This clause establishes that machine learning training is a named data collection activity, meaning user data may be used in and collected during model training processes.
Interpretive note: The excerpt is a short noun phrase without surrounding context, making it unclear what the full clause establishes about how or from whom data is collected in this context. The canonical claim is limited strictly to what the phrase states.
Data is collected from you as part of Midjourney's machine learning training process.
